What is an Energy Performance Certificate?

The Climate Change Act 2008 commits Government to reduce overall carbon emissions by at least 80% by 2050. Meeting this target will require a change in energy efficiency of existing buildings and household energy use.

A step foward to achieving this target was the introduction of EPC's. All buildings, whenever they are built, sold or rented out, require an EPC.

The certificate will give prospective purchasers an easy to read guide to the likely energy costs of occupying the property, as well as recommendations on how to improve its efficiency.
